3.3.3 Methods to Determine the Thermal Diffusivity3.3.4 Experimental Setup and Technique Validation"This book covers the new technologies on micro/nanoscale thermal characterization developed in the Micro/Nanoscale Thermal Science Laboratory led by Dr. Xinwei Wang. Five new non-contact and non-destructive technologies are introduced: optical heating and electrical sensing technique, transient electro-thermal technique, transient photo-electro-thermal technique, pulsed laser-assisted thermal relaxation technique, and steady-state electro-Raman-thermal technique. These techniques feature significantly improved ease of implementation, super signal-to-noise ratio, and have the capacity of measuring the thermal conductivity/diffusivity of various one-dimensional structures from dielectric, semiconductive, to metallic materials"--Provided by publisher.Nanostructured materialsThermal propertiesHeatTransmissionNanostructured materialsThermal properties.HeatTransmission.620.1/1596TEC027000bisacshWang Xinwei1948-1708182MiAaPQMiAaPQMiAaPQBOOK9910821649303321Experimental micro4097017UNINA
